Job Description


Are you a skilled, thoughtful designer ready to make an impact? As a UX Designer in ES Tech, you will be responsible for crafting the next generation of HR products. In this role, your design work has a direct impact on the lives of millions of Amazonians, helping them address their HR needs efficiently while still feeling personal and human.

We're looking for a Senior UX Designer with a passion for improving the customer experience and driving high-visibility programs. In this role, you will lead the design vision, strategy and execution of customer experiences that get upstream and are created to scale. You'll advocate for accessible design and work backwards from customer problems and needs. You will work closely with other UX designers and researchers on the team, product managers, engineers, and business stakeholders to understand the needs of employees, managers, and HR team members across all of Amazon?s businesses, worldwide. You'll drive UX design from early-stage concepts all the way through final delivery and launch.

Key job responsibilities

Own end-to-end product experiences that are accessible, delight customers, and deliver on business objectives.

Create user flows, wireframes, prototypes, high-fidelity designs with detailed specifications, and functional prototypes for mobile and web interfaces.

Champion a user-centered design culture through creative collaborations. Build cross-functional partnerships to deliver seamless customer-centric experiences.

Present design work to cross-functional teams, stakeholders, and leadership for feedback and review.

Develop and drive the adoption of design guidelines, best practices, processes, and tools across the organization.

Contribute to the professional development of your team and colleagues through coaching, mentorship, and modeling Amazon's leadership principles.

About the team

The Amazon Employee Services Technology (ES Tech) team is building cutting edge solutions to streamline human resource processes. Our team includes UX Researchers, Designers, Product Managers, and Engineers. We work on projects ranging from rapid, iterative design on tactical projects, to major strategic efforts that rethink how we provide support to our employees. We work together with internal stakeholders to create user experiences that help, surprise and delight.

Basic Qualifications

6+ years of design experience

Have an available online portfolio

Experience with design tools such as Photoshop, Illustrator and InDesign and prototyping in HTML, JavaScript, CSS, Ajax

Preferred Qualifications

Experience applying scrum to visual or UX design processes

Experience with UX design of complex workflows

Experience in delivering design solutions for projects of large scope and complexity

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ets. The base pay for this position ranges from $127,100/year in our lowest geographic market up to $211,600/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Amazon is a total compensation company. Dependent on the position offered, equity, sign-on payments, and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package, in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its.
